The Asterism Beanie is a beginner pattern that uses the linen stitch and three colours to produce a dense fabric, perfect as a unisex beanie and for using up all those yarn scraps!

The pattern was inspired by the release of the Malabrigo Zodiac collection in their worsted weight Rios yarn. It utilises the three colours of the main zodiac signs, our sun, moon, and rising signs. Of course you can combine any three colours in your chosen yarn weight, or even try your hand at using a single colour or more than three!

The pattern is written for five yarn weights: worsted, light bulky, bulky, light super bulky and super bulky with the option to make with a standard or folded brim.

The Asterism beanie is a tight fitting beanie and the fabric created using linen stitch for the body of the beanie creates a density that is sure to keep out the most bitter winter winds! The shape and fit is also ideally suited for use as a unisex beanie.

Method ~

Knitted from the brim up in the round.

Skill level ~

Beginner. Pattern includes written, pictorial and video instructions.

Yarn weights ~

Worsted, light bulky, bulky, light super bulky and super bulky.

Suggested Yarn ~

Worsted: Malabrigo Rios, Washted or Worsted (192 m/210 yds per 100 g)
Light Bulky: Malabrigo Mecha (119 m/130 yds per 100 g)
Bulky: Malabrigo Chunky (95 m/104 yds per 100 g)
Light Super Bulky: Malabrigo Noventa (66 m/72 yd per 100 g)
Super bulky: Malabrigo Rasta (55 m/60 yd per 100 g)

Any yarn can be substituted providing the correct gauge and a suitable fabric are achieved.

Size ~

Adult/teen with suggested alterations to pattern to knit any size.
